    St. John’s Co-Cathedral is one of Malta’s most impressive landmarks, located in the heart of Valletta. Built in the 16th century by the Knights of St. John, the cathedral is renowned for its richly decorated Baroque interior, marble tombs, and ornate chapels. It also houses famous masterpieces by Caravaggio, including The Beheading of Saint John the Baptist. A visit here offers deep insight into Malta’s religious history, art, and architecture.     Hagar Qim & Mnajdra Archaeological Park

    Ħaġar Qim & Mnajdra Temples are among Malta’s most remarkable prehistoric sites and are listed as UNESCO World Heritage Sites. Located on a scenic hill overlooking the Mediterranean Sea, these ancient temples date back over 5,000 years and showcase impressive stone structures and advanced architectural design for their time. Visitors can explore the ruins, learn about Malta’s early civilizations, and enjoy stunning coastal views.     Mdina, famously known as “The Silent City,” is Malta’s ancient fortified capital and one of the most atmospheric destinations on the island. Surrounded by massive stone walls, Mdina features narrow winding streets, medieval architecture, and historic palaces that reflect centuries of history. Walking through the city feels like stepping back in time, offering peaceful surroundings and beautiful panoramic views of Malta from the bastions.
